探究C8051F040/1/2/3/4/5/6/7 8K ISP FLASH MCU家族的強(qiáng)大性能與應(yīng)用潛力
在電子工程師的日常工作中,選擇一款合適的微控制器(MCU)至關(guān)重要。今天我們要深入剖析的是C8051F040/1/2/3/4/5/6/7 8K ISP FLASH MCU家族,看看它究竟有哪些獨(dú)特之處。
文件下載:C8051F042.pdf
架構(gòu)與性能
高速8051 μC核心
C8051F040系列采用了流水線指令架構(gòu),能夠在1或2個(gè)系統(tǒng)時(shí)鐘內(nèi)執(zhí)行70%的指令集。當(dāng)配備25MHz時(shí)鐘時(shí),其吞吐量最高可達(dá)25MIPS。擁有20個(gè)向量中斷源,這意味著它能夠快速響應(yīng)各種外部事件,在復(fù)雜的工業(yè)控制、通信等領(lǐng)域有著很好的表現(xiàn)。想想看,在需要快速數(shù)據(jù)處理和實(shí)時(shí)響應(yīng)的場景中,這樣的高性能核心是不是能讓你的設(shè)計(jì)更加穩(wěn)定可靠?
豐富的內(nèi)存配置
內(nèi)部數(shù)據(jù)RAM達(dá)到4352字節(jié)(4k + 256),不同型號的Flash存儲器容量有所不同,C8051F040/1/2/3/4/5為64 kB,而C8051F046/7為32 kB,并且支持在系統(tǒng)編程,以512字節(jié)扇區(qū)為單位進(jìn)行操作。同時(shí),還具備外部64 kB數(shù)據(jù)存儲器接口,可選擇可編程復(fù)用或非復(fù)用模式,這為數(shù)據(jù)存儲和處理提供了極大的靈活性,你可以根據(jù)項(xiàng)目需求合理規(guī)劃內(nèi)存使用。
模擬外設(shè)
10或12位SAR ADC
不同型號的該系列MCU分辨率有所差異,C8051F040/1為12位,C8051F042/3/4/5/6/7為10位,± 1 LSB INL保證了無漏碼現(xiàn)象,可編程吞吐量高達(dá)100 ksps。擁有13個(gè)外部輸入通道,支持單端或差分輸入方式,還配備了軟件可編程的高壓差分放大器,放大器增益可在16、8、4、2、1、0.5之間選擇。內(nèi)置數(shù)據(jù)相關(guān)的窗口中斷發(fā)生器和溫度傳感器,為數(shù)據(jù)采集和處理帶來更多便利。在需要高精度數(shù)據(jù)采集的應(yīng)用場景,如工業(yè)自動化中的傳感器數(shù)據(jù)采集,它能發(fā)揮出強(qiáng)大的性能優(yōu)勢。
8位SAR ADC(僅C8051F040/1/2/3)
可編程吞吐量最高可達(dá)500 ksps,有8個(gè)外部輸入通道,同樣支持單端或差分輸入,放大器增益可編程為4、2、1、0.5。
12位DAC(僅C8051F040/1/2/3)
具備兩個(gè)12位DAC,可將輸出與定時(shí)器同步,實(shí)現(xiàn)無抖動的波形生成,為音頻處理、信號發(fā)生器等應(yīng)用提供了很好的支持。
模擬比較器
有三個(gè)模擬比較器,其遲滯和響應(yīng)時(shí)間均可編程,可根據(jù)實(shí)際需求靈活調(diào)整比較器的性能。
電壓參考與監(jiān)測
提供精密的 (V_{DD}) 監(jiān)測和欠壓檢測器,保證系統(tǒng)在電壓不穩(wěn)定的情況下也能正常工作。
數(shù)字外設(shè)
端口I/O
不同型號的端口I/O有所不同,C8051F040/2/4/6為8字節(jié)寬端口I/O,C8051F041/3/5/7為5V耐受的4字節(jié)寬端口I/O,能滿足不同的接口需求。
通信接口
集成了博世控制器局域網(wǎng)(CAN 2.0B)、硬件SMBus?( (I^{2} C^{T mu}) C? 兼容)、SPI? 和兩個(gè)UART串行端口,可同時(shí)使用,方便與其他設(shè)備進(jìn)行通信,適用于汽車電子、工業(yè)控制等多設(shè)備互聯(lián)的場景。
計(jì)數(shù)器/定時(shí)器
擁有可編程的16位計(jì)數(shù)器/定時(shí)器陣列,包含6個(gè)捕獲/比較模塊,5個(gè)通用的16位計(jì)數(shù)器/定時(shí)器,以及專用的看門狗定時(shí)器和雙向復(fù)位引腳,能實(shí)現(xiàn)各種定時(shí)、計(jì)數(shù)和控制功能。
時(shí)鐘源與電源管理
時(shí)鐘源選擇
內(nèi)部校準(zhǔn)的可編程振蕩器頻率范圍為3到24.5 MHz,也可選擇外部振蕩器,如晶體、RC、C或時(shí)鐘。還能使用定時(shí)器2、3、4或PCA實(shí)現(xiàn)實(shí)時(shí)時(shí)鐘模式,為系統(tǒng)提供了多種時(shí)鐘選擇方案,可根據(jù)不同的應(yīng)用場景選擇最合適的時(shí)鐘源。
電源管理
供電電壓范圍為2.7到3.6 V,支持多種省電睡眠和關(guān)機(jī)模式,有助于降低系統(tǒng)功耗,延長設(shè)備的續(xù)航時(shí)間,在一些對功耗要求較高的便攜式設(shè)備中具有很大優(yōu)勢。
封裝與溫度范圍
提供100引腳和64引腳的TQFP封裝,能適應(yīng)不同的PCB布局需求。工作溫度范圍為–40到 +85 °C,可在較為惡劣的環(huán)境條件下穩(wěn)定工作。
C8051F040/1/2/3/4/5/6/7 8K ISP FLASH MCU家族憑借其高性能的核心、豐富的外設(shè)資源、靈活的配置和良好的電源管理特性,在眾多電子應(yīng)用領(lǐng)域都有著廣闊的應(yīng)用前景。作為電子工程師,你是否已經(jīng)在考慮將它應(yīng)用到你的下一個(gè)項(xiàng)目中呢?
-
性能特點(diǎn)
+關(guān)注
關(guān)注
0文章
25瀏覽量
5473
發(fā)布評論請先 登錄
探究C8051F040/1/2/3/4/5/6/7 8K ISP FLASH MCU家族的強(qiáng)大性能與應(yīng)用潛力
評論